Lagos resumes COVID-19 vaccination Wednesday

Vaccination against COVID-19 will resume on Wednesday in Lagos State with the administration of Moderna vaccine, Governor Babajide Sanwo-Olu has said. Sanwo-Olu, who gave updates on the fight against the virus said of the 601,000 doses promised Lagos about 299,000 doses of the Moderna vaccines were received from the Federal Government. BREAKING: Industrial Court orders resident doctors to suspend strike

The National Industrial Court in Abuja has ordered the National Association of Resident Doctors (NARD) to suspend its ongoing strike. Justice John Targema gave the order on Monday in an ex parte application by the Federal Government.
